How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Pembroke Pines?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Pembroke Pines Studio Apartments | $1,505 | $543 | $2,707 |
Pembroke Pines 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,116 | $469 | $3,879 |
| Pembroke Pines 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,640 | $1,438 | $5,165 |
| Pembroke Pines 3 Bedroom Apartments | $3,113 | $1,836 | $5,636 |
| Pembroke Pines 4 Bedroom Apartments | $7,368 | $6,800 | $7,936 |

Frequently Asked Questions about 1 Bedroom Pembroke Pines Apartments
What is the Cheapest apartment in Pembroke Pines with 1 Bedroom?
Currently the most affordable 1 Bedroom in Pembroke Pines is at Pembroke Tower II listed at $1,222.
How much is the average rent for a 1 Bedroom Pembroke Pines Apartment?
The average rent for a 1 Bedroom Apartment in Pembroke Pines is $2,116.
What is the largest available 1 Bedroom Pembroke Pines Apartment for rent?
Today's apartment with the most square footage in Pembroke Pines is a 1,001 square feet unit starting from $2,381 at Windsor Pembroke Pines.
What is the average size for Pembroke Pines 1 Bedroom Apartments for rent?
The average size for a 1 Bedroom rental in Pembroke Pines is currently 771 sq ft.
